Tom McLeish, "The Poetry and Music of Science: Comparing Creativity in Science and Art" (Oxford UP, 2021)

New Books in Literary Studies

Play Episode Listen Later Dec 20, 2022 35:27


What human qualities are needed to make scientific discoveries, and which to make great art? Many would point to 'imagination' and 'creativity' in the second case but not the first. Tom McLeish's The Poetry and Music of Science: Comparing Creativity in Science and Art (Oxford UP, 2021) challenges the assumption that doing science is in any sense less creative than art, music or fictional writing and poetry, and treads a historical and contemporary path through common territories of the creative process. The methodological process called the 'scientific method' tells us how to test ideas when we have had them, but not how to arrive at hypotheses in the first place. Hearing the stories that scientists and artists tell about their projects reveals commonalities: the desire for a goal, the experience of frustration and failure, the incubation of the problem, moments of sudden insight, and the experience of the beautiful or sublime. Selected themes weave the practice of science and art together: visual thinking and metaphor, the transcendence of music and mathematics, the contemporary rise of the English novel and experimental science, and the role of aesthetics and desire in the creative process. Artists and scientists make salient comparisons: Defoe and Boyle; Emmerson and Humboldt, Monet and Einstein, Schumann and Hadamard. The book draws on medieval philosophy at many points as the product of the last age that spent time in inner contemplation of the mystery of how something is mentally brought out from nothing. Taking the phenomenon of the rainbow as an example, the principles of creativity within constraint point to the scientific imagination as a parallel of poetry. And about almost 10 years ago, my friend and colleague Tom McLeish, who's a theoretical physicist and a lay theologian, and I were speculating about what happened when senior Christian leaders, such as bishops, or leaders of other denominations, or leaders of parachurch organizations, those organizations that span different churches, were asked about science. And one of the things that we noticed was that senior church leaders often responded with fear, or negativity, or silence. And the problem with that is that then those who serve as Christian leaders under them, if they come from a scientific background, if your senior leader responds with fear or negativity or silence, then that doesn't really affirm what you're bringing to ministry, in terms of your interest or passion about science. And then that ripples down into congregations, where disciples who live out their lives with a vocation to be scientists, technologists are in Engineers, they're not affirmed in their vocation. And of course, that then ripples out to reinforce this very dominant model of relationship between science and religion, that conflict model of science and religion or independence, that the two have to be separated. And so we thought, Is there a project to be done where we can equip Christian leaders to engage with science with joy, with humility, with confidence with excitement? And that would have a ripple down effect throughout the church?   Zack Jackson 05:36 Yes, I mentioned I resonate with this. This is the this is the project that I'm working on for my doctrine ministry program right now, creating resources for pastors to engage, to equip them to have these conversations because it is just so important. So in what ways have since you started this program? How have you been able to start equipping leaders,   David Wilkinson 06:00 one of the things we first realized sack was the importance of personal relationships and conversations. And so we started with, with conferences, where we would invite a small group of senior leaders, intentionally inviting them to come here to Durham. And we would take them into science departments, where we introduce them to world class scientists. Now, sometimes, in this work, organizations will choose a scientist who happens to be a Christian. We didn't do that. We just went for world class scientists, whatever their religious backgrounds, and we threw the bishops into their labs. And we got these people to talk about their own science and their work. And it was just terrific from cosmology and simulating universes through to biology, genetics, we even had one wonderful incident where we took 30 bishops into one of our engineering labs here in Durham, where we have small robots, six of them, artificial intelligent robots, humanoid robots, and the bishops were kind of pressed against the wall. Worried about this, these little robots who are wandering round, and the robots went up to the bishops, and started to talk to them. And suddenly the bishops move towards the center of the room, as they started conversing with these robots. And I wish I'd had a video camera to show you. And in a sense, we start with with bishops who are a little worried about science. And slowly they move into the center. And part of that is talking to research students, and talking with professors, and actually seeing that these folk work in science, because they're passionate about finding out about the universe, or they're passionate about helping society and other people, that some of the the big, bad images of science are not quite true when you meet scientists themselves. And we brought into that conversation, then theologians into the conference, to help decode some of the issues of play within the interplay of science and theology. And so this bringing together of people to talk together, and what we found, was after the sessions, the bishops were thrilled to have encountered science. And the scientists were thrilled to encounter bishops, and other senior church leaders who took science seriously. And many of the scientists without any Christian commitment turned up at the bar later on in the conference, to talk more with the bishops. I think there's something really important about that kind of interaction of people, that learning not just about the science in the abstract, but science in terms of it being done by scientists. And then we thought to ourselves, Well, there's one or two other things that we really need to do about this. So we've had a research strand, where we've interviewed 1000, clergy and a number of bishops and senior church leaders about what they really think about science. That's been an important thing. And we might want to go on to some of those findings in a little bit. We've also followed the US in a program called Science for seminaries and working with church leaders are beginning of their ministries. And then we wanted to provide some model situations where people could see how a local congregation could use the scientists within their congregations to do something fruitful for the kingdom, either for the church or for the community. And we call that scientists in congregations. And that's a program that's been used in lots of different parts of the world. And then the final strand that we've done, which is peculiar to the UK, in the UK, the Church of England is the established church. It has a lot of political and media presence. There are bishops in the House of Lords, for example, scrutinizing legislation. And so we embedded a team member within the church of England's work in that area, to assist on some of the questions such as fracking, or AI, that are going through legislation to help Christian leaders give sensible voices within the public debate. There were some very interesting findings in there, would you care to tell us a little bit about   David Wilkinson 17:17 Yes, absolutely. And some things that surprised us. We wanted to serve a clergy first of all, and we surveyed about 1000 of them from all different churches and backgrounds. And one of the most surprising things was how often they find themselves talking about science, or engaging with people about science in their ministry. Now, we didn't expect that to be the case. Although looking back on my own ministry, I was a pastor for a decade, in full time, work leading a church. I remember, it was in Liverpool, just off Penny Lane for those who remember the Beatles. And we used to run a luncheon club, where, on a Wednesday lunchtime, we would gather together some elderly folk and provide them with a fairly basic but nutritious and wholesome lunch. And I remember going to a lady who was very elderly, and left school at the age of 14. And I would normally wander around and say hello to people. And I sat down at her table. And she looked at me and said, Now then David, she said, What's this Stephen Hawking and quantum gravity all about? And what does this mean for God? Now, I think sometimes we underestimate the kinds of questions that people have. And so we found that clergy were often addressing questions about the environment, questions about genetics, questions about what does it mean to be human? These big questions, and yet, often, they felt a little bit of a lack of confidence in engaging with these questions. And I think that partly comes from this conflict model, which is so embedded within Western tradition, which you found in the New Atheists. So for Richard Dawkins and others, you now find in many stand up comedians, who also represent the conflict model. But I think sometimes it's also about those subtle messages from the church that has said, Beware of science. And they've often coupled science with images of the Tower of Babel with trying to replace God or atheism. So I think we found that I think we also found and this is, this is something which really fascinated me. And that is the Sometimes the how why distinction becomes a avoidance mechanism for deeper theological questions. What I mean by that, is that when we talk about science and theology, and I often do this myself, we can talk about science about the how, and theology about the why, when it comes to the origin of the universe, for example, my area of, of work and science and, you know, quantum gravity, and is the how of God doing it. Questions of purpose and meaning or value is why, and that's a useful first order distinction. But we found that many senior church leaders were using it as a way to avoid some of the deeper questions. So if you use the how wide distinction, you can perhaps avoid the question, well, how does God really work in the universe? How does God work in healing in miracles in prayer? How is God involved in the laws of physics or not? Now, those can be quite scary questions to folk. But they're important questions for many people. And then I think we I think the third thing that we found was sometimes this fear of certain ways that science has been used, protect, particularly when it comes to theories of evolution. So although there was an openness to assessing scientific theories, there was a sense of those who have used the post Darwinian controversies to argue against Christianity, and to use some scientific theories and evolution and sociobiology. Sometimes I used to argue that once you have a scientific understanding of something, it's nothing but that. So religion could be seen and the way that it's developed, and its socio biological, biological origin. But then that quick move to say, and that's all it is. That's the mistake. Physicist Tom McLeish begs to disagree. --- “We forget, in science, that what we call the scientific method is really only the method for a tiny bit of science. It's the only bit of science that there can be a method for, which is testing out and checking our hypotheses when we've got them. The really crucial step in science is to get good ideas going in the first place, to have great new insights, to imagine whole new structures of the world, or fungus on the trees, or black holes, or whatever it might be. Now, there really is no method for having great, innovative, scientific, imaginative, creative ideas. So where do they come from?” Tom McLeish is a physicist and author, and talks about science more enthusiastically than anyone else you’ll ever meet. His current title is Professor of Natural Philosophy at the University of York - and “natural philosophy” is far from the only unusual term he likes to use when talking about science.  His latest book is The Poetry and Music of Science: Comparing Creativity in Science and Art, and in this conversation he explains what being a scientist and being an artist have in common; why it is that experimental science and the English novel got going at about the same time; and why he thinks the “book of nature” might be written in poetry rather than prose. The story of how Newton came up with his gravitational theory is one of the most familiar in the history of science. He was sitting in the orchard at Woolsthorpe, thinking deep thoughts, when an apple fell from a tree. And all at once, Newton realised that the force of gravity pulling the apple down to the ground must be the same as the force that holds the moon in orbit around the earth. But was that really how he came up with his great idea? These days, historians of science don’t fall for cosy eureka stories like this. Rather they say that new understanding comes slowly, through hard graft, false trails, and failed ideas. Philip Ball tells the story of the life and ideas of Isaac Newton, who was born on Christmas Day in 1642. Philip discusses with historian of science Anna Marie Roos of the University of Lincoln, just 30 miles north of Woolsthorpe, how Newton developed his theory of gravity . And he talks to Tom McLeish of the University of York, the author of a book about creativity in science and art, about his observation that many scientists today do think they have had eureka moments. Tom McLeish, “Faith and Wisdom in Science” (Oxford UP, 2014)

New Books in Physics and Chemistry

Play Episode Listen Later May 22, 2015 51:12


Much of the public debate about the relationship between science and theology has been antagonistic or adversarial. Proponents on both sides argue that their respective claims are contradictory–that the claims of science trump and even discredit the claims of religion or theology. Some have sought to portray the relationship in a different light. The evolutionary biologist Stephen J. Gould famously asserted that the two realms were “nonoverlapping magisteria.” But recently theologians and scientists have begun to mark out new ground for robust conversation. Tom McLeish‘s book Faith and Wisdom in Science (Oxford University Press, 2014) takes this conversation to new heights. Locating the impulse for science in much biblical literature, particularly the wisdom books of the Hebrew Bible, he shows how one might understand science as a theological endeavor. Rather than a paradigm of “science and theology,” he posits a “theology of science,” an interrelationship that not only gives us new eyes with which to read the history of science more coherently but also yields a renewed appreciation for science as part of a “ministry of reconciliation” with the natural world and the causes of human suffering. Tom McLeish is Professor of Physics and former Pro-Vice-Chancellor for Research at Durham University. He studied for his first degree and PhD in polymer physics at the University of Cambridge and in 1987 became a lecturer in physics at the University of Sheffield. In 1993 he took the chair in polymer physics at the University of Leeds. He took up his current position in Durham in 2008. He is a fellow of the Institute of Physics, the Royal Society of Chemistry, the American Physical Society, and the Royal Society. He is also involved in science communication with the public via radio, television, and school lectures, discussing topics ranging from the physics of slime to the interaction of faith and science. A Book at Lunchtime discussion with Tom McLeish, Sally Shuttleworth, John Christie and Ard A. Louis An interdisciplinary discussion about Tom McLeish's "Faith and Wisdom in Science". About the book: "Do you have wisdom to count the clouds?" asks the voice of God from the whirlwind in the stunningly beautiful catalogue of nature-questions from the Old Testament Book of Job. Tom McLeish takes a scientist's reading of this ancient text as a centrepiece to make the case for science as a deeply human and ancient activity, embedded in some of the oldest stories told about human desire to understand the natural world. Drawing on stories from the modern science of chaos and uncertainty alongside medieval, patristic, classical and Biblical sources, Faith and Wisdom in Science challenges much of the current 'science and religion' debate as operating with the wrong assumptions and in the wrong space. Its narrative approach develops a natural critique of the cultural separation of sciences and humanities, suggesting an approach to science, or in its more ancient form natural philosophy - the 'love of wisdom of natural things' - that can draw on theological and cultural roots. Following the theme of pain in human confrontation with nature, it develops a 'Theology of Science', recognising that both scientific and theological worldviews must be 'of' each other, not holding separate domains. Science finds its place within an old story of participative reconciliation with a nature, of which we start ignorant and fearful, but learn to perceive and work with in wisdom. Surprisingly, science becomes a deeply religious activity. There are urgent lessons for education, the political process of decision-making on science and technology, our relationship with the global environment, and the way that both religious and secular communities alike celebrate and govern science.
